New Hampshire HB 1127 (2024) — relative to the revocation and suspension of drivers' licenses and to invalidating out-of-state driver's licenses issued to undocumented immigrants.

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- 2023-11-28 Introduced 01/03/2024 and referred to Transportation
introduction, referral-committee - 2024-01-11 Public Hearing: 01/16/2024 11:20 am LOB 203 HC 2
- 2024-01-25 Executive Session: 01/30/2024 02:00 pm LOB 203
- 2024-02-01 Committee Report: Ought to Pass 01/30/2024 (Vote 19-0; CC)
committee-passage-favorable - 2024-02-08 Ought to Pass: MA VV 02/08/2024 HJ 4 P. 13
committee-passage-favorable, passage - 2024-02-26 Introduced 02/21/2024 and Referred to Judiciary; SJ 6
introduction, referral-committee - 2024-04-30 Hearing: 05/07/2024, Room 100, SH, 01:15 pm; SC 18
- 2024-05-15 Committee Report: Ought to Pass, 05/22/2024; Vote 5-0; CC; SC 20
committee-passage-favorable - 2024-05-22 Sen. Gannon Moved to Remove HB 1127 from the Consent Calendar; 05/22/2024; SJ 14
- 2024-05-22 Special Order to the end of the calendar on 05/23/2024, Without Objection, MA; 05/22/2024; SJ 14
- 2024-05-23 Special Order to after Judiciary, Without Objection, MA; 05/23/2024; SJ 15
- 2024-05-23 Sen. Gannon Floor Amendment # 2024-2116s, AA, VV; 05/23/2024; SJ 15
- 2024-05-23 Ought to Pass with Amendment 2024-2116s, MA, VV; OT3rdg; 05/23/2024; SJ 15
committee-passage-favorable, passage - 2024-05-29 House Non-Concurs with Senate Amendment 2024-2116s and Requests CofC (Reps. T. Walsh, Sykes, Coker, Gorski): MA VV 05/29/2024 HJ 14 P. 179
- 2024-05-30 Sen. Carson Accedes to House Request for Committee of Conference, MA, VV; 05/30/2024; SJ 16
- 2024-05-30 President Appoints: Senators Carson, Bradley, Chandley; 05/30/2024; SJ 16
- 2024-06-04 Conference Committee Meeting: 06/04/2024 02:00 pm LOB 203
- 2024-05-31 Conferee Change: Rep. Veilleux Replaces Rep. Coker 05/31/2024 HJ 15 P. 34
- 2024-06-04 Conferee Change: Rep. S. Smith Replaces Rep. Gorski 06/04/2024 HJ 15 P. 35
- 2024-06-06 Conference Committee Meeting: 06/06/2024 09:00 am LOB 203
- 2024-06-06 Conference Committee Report Filed, # 2024-2284c; 06/13/2024
- 2024-06-12 Conference Committee Report # 2024-2284c, Adopted, VV; 06/13/2024; SJ 17
- 2024-06-13 Special Order to the end of the day unless otherwise ordered by the Senate, Without Objection, MA; 06/13/2024; SJ 17
- 2024-06-13 Conference Committee Report 2024-2284c: Adopted, VV 06/13/2024 HJ 16 P. 27
- 2024-07-18 Enrolled Adopted, VV, (In recess 06/13/2024); SJ 18
enrolled - 2024-07-23 Enrolled (in recess of) 06/13/2024 HJ 16 P. 56
- 2024-08-07 Signed by Governor Sununu 08/02/2024; Chapter 328; eff. 01/01/2025 HJ 16
executive-signature
